Timeline

The legislative action history — every referral, reading, and vote.

  • 2021-11-12T06:00:00+00:00 Introduced by Representatives Snyder, Magnafici, Doyle, Kerkman, Milroy, Spiros, Duchow, Considine, Andraca, Rozar, Vruwink, Ohnstad, Wichgers, Subeck, Dittrich, Loudenbeck, Plumer, Bowen and Stubbs; cosponsored by Senators Kooyenga, Johnson, Bernier, Ballweg and Cowles introduction
  • 2021-11-12T06:00:00+00:00 Read first time and referred to Committee on Substance Abuse and Prevention reading-1, referral-committee
  • 2021-11-16T06:00:00+00:00 Fiscal estimate received receipt
  • 2022-01-13T06:00:00+00:00 Public hearing held
  • 2022-01-18T06:00:00+00:00 Executive action taken
  • 2022-01-18T06:00:00+00:00 Representative Cabrera added as a coauthor
  • 2022-01-18T06:00:00+00:00 Report passage recommended by Committee on Substance Abuse and Prevention, Ayes 8, Noes 0 committee-passage-favorable
  • 2022-01-18T06:00:00+00:00 Referred to committee on Rules referral-committee
  • 2022-01-18T06:00:00+00:00 Placed on calendar 1-20-2022 by Committee on Rules
  • 2022-01-20T06:00:00+00:00 Read a second time reading-2
  • 2022-01-20T06:00:00+00:00 Ordered to a third reading reading-3
  • 2022-01-20T06:00:00+00:00 Rules suspended
  • 2022-01-20T06:00:00+00:00 Read a third time and passed passage, reading-3
  • 2022-01-20T06:00:00+00:00 Ordered immediately messaged
  • 2022-01-20T06:00:00+00:00 Received from Assembly receipt
  • 2022-01-21T06:00:00+00:00 Read first time and referred to committee on Senate Organization referral-committee
  • 2022-01-21T06:00:00+00:00 Available for scheduling
  • 2022-01-21T06:00:00+00:00 Public hearing requirement waived by committee on Senate Organization, pursuant to Senate Rule 18 (1m), Ayes 5, Noes 0
  • 2022-01-21T06:00:00+00:00 Placed on calendar 1-25-2022 pursuant to Senate Rule 18(1)
  • 2022-01-25T06:00:00+00:00 Read a second time reading-2
  • 2022-01-25T06:00:00+00:00 Ordered to a third reading reading-3
  • 2022-01-25T06:00:00+00:00 Rules suspended
  • 2022-01-25T06:00:00+00:00 Read a third time and concurred in passage, reading-3
  • 2022-01-25T06:00:00+00:00 Ordered immediately messaged
  • 2022-01-25T06:00:00+00:00 Received from Senate concurred in receipt
  • 2022-01-31T06:00:00+00:00 Report correctly enrolled on 1-31-2022 enrolled
  • 2022-04-04T05:00:00+00:00 Presented to the Governor on 4-4-2022 by directive of the Speaker executive-receipt
  • 2022-04-08T05:00:00+00:00 Report approved by the Governor on 4-8-2022. 2021 Wisconsin Act 222 executive-signature
  • 2022-04-08T05:00:00+00:00 Published 4-9-2022 became-law
